4.1.2 Output Assembly
The following parameters are used in the output assembly of the
PLX51-HART-4O
module.
Table 4.2 – PLX51-HART-4O Logix 5000 output assembly parameters
Parameter
Datatype Description
Ch0_Data
REAL
Analog output value (in engineering units) for Channel
0.
Ch1_Data
REAL
Analog output value (in engineering units) for Channel
1.
Ch2_Data
REAL
Analog output value (in engineering units) for Channel
2.
Ch3_Data
REAL
Analog output value (in engineering units) for Channel
3.
4.1.3 HART Relay Message
The module supports the relaying of custom HART commands to the field device.
This is achieved by building the HART command request and then sending it to the
module using an explicit message instruction. An example of this is shown in the
figure below.
